>Dfx-, 2010-05-24: I understand where you're coming from and was expecting a query. How I see it is as follows:

Book 1: Names main character John Smith.

Book 2: Names its main character Supercalifragilistic Expealadocious.

The first name is acceptable, the second is not. Whether they are a book character is irrelevant...it is whether they are real and proper names to begin with. Just because the second book has its name of its main character does not make its name therefore real.

The team of assistants have all learned weird and wonderful names that are valid in many languages within accepting or rejecting them. I have just accepted "Dung Nguyen" as there is someone called Dung Nguyen in this world. I was surprised as anyone. He may also be a book film or cartoon character as well, but it is a real name and gets accepted.

If there's evidence of people called Sindbad, I or any of us will be glad to accept.
